Payne Whitney

William Payne Whitney acquired $63 million from his uncle and spent much of his time utilizing it for philanthropy. His present to New York Hospital enabled the facility of the world-famous Payne Whitney Psychiatric Clinic. It was built in 1930-1932 as part of the New York-Cornell Medical Center complex at 525 East 68th Street.

It was a location for wealthy patients to fix their shattered psyches, an antipode to the chaotic turmoil of Bellevue Hospital. It was developed like a stylish hotel with a marble-floored lobby, comfortable furniture and an elaborate fireplace. But it was also engineered for insanity, with hydrotherapy tanks, steel-framed sash windows that opened less than 5 inches to avoid suicide and soundproof ceilings. The rooms were equipped with Thorazine, an effective drug that might soothe the most manic client.

Under the aegis of Dr. Diethelm, Payne Whitney ended up being a national leader in research study and treatment. He personally met every homeowner and patient each week. However the inbound chairman, Dr. William Lhamon, did not have the very same passion for teaching. Education mostly fell by the wayside as Lhamon focused on constructing a first-class research institute.

In 1974, when Dr. Robert Michels became chairman, he reclaimed the significance of teaching and recognized Payne Whitney as one of the premier psychiatry residency programs in America. He brought psychoanalytic rigor to the program and strengthened clinical and research efforts.
